Checking to see what apps are starting automatically is a breeze. Select the Apple menu and System Preferences. Select Users & Groups and then the Login Items tab in the top center. The list of enabled apps will appear in the center pane. Apps that appear in that center pane will automatically open when you. To jump to an open app on Mac, click the icon on the Dock, and the app’s window will pop up. Clicking the icon will also launch an app if it is not currently running. To shut down or quit an app directly from the Dock, right-click or Ctrl-click the icon and choose Quit. Open the Force Quit Applications Menu. If you have an open app on Mac.

The official desktop app was first announced over a year ago, with an early release making its way to the Mac App Store in early March. That version was only available for a limited number of users though, and only in certain regions. Now, Messenger is available for everyone, everywhere.
